Troy Polamalu Fined: Steelers Star Punished For Using Cell Phone To Call Wife During Game

Steelers Star Fined For Using Cell Phone During Game

The NFL has been somewhat harsh when it comes to fines for these violations. But the "No Fun League" might receive an enormous negative backlash for this one.

Pittsburgh Steelers safety Troy Polamalu was fined $10,000 for using a cell phone on the sideline during Sunday's game against the Jacksonville Jaguars. He had to leave the game due to concussion-like symptoms and according to coach Mike Tomlin (per the Pittsburgh Tribune-Review), he borrowed a cell phone from a doctor to inform his wife, Theodora, that he was okay.

Polamalu would pass a concussion test a few days later and is expected to play against the Arizona Cardinals on Sunday.

The Pro Bowler was fined $15,000 after Week 1 for making a horse-collar tackle on Baltimore Ravens running back Ricky Williams.
